What is Homeworld: Emergence?

Homeworld: Emergence puts you at the helm of a fledgling fleet, guiding it through epic battles and deep-space exploration. With a blend of real‑time strategy, simulation, and sci‑fi storytelling, the game delivers a richly detailed universe to conquer alone or with friends. Featuring both single‑player campaigns and multiplayer skirmishes, the title offers a timeless challenge for strategy lovers, while its intuitive controls and immersive visuals keep newcomers engaged.
